Press Release No. (721) issued by the Government Media Office:

The Government Media Office publishes an update of the most important statistics of the genocidal war waged by the "Israeli" occupation on the Gaza Strip for day 460 - Wednesday, January 8, 2025:

◻️ (460) days since the genocidal war.
◻️ (10,015) massacres committed by the occupation army in general.
◻️ (7,182) massacres committed by the "Israeli" occupation against Palestinian families. (Ministry of Health).
◻️ (1,600) Palestinian families were exterminated by the occupation and erased from the civil registry, by killing the father, mother and all family members, and the number of members of these families is 5,612 martyrs. (Ministry of Health).
◻️ (3,471) Palestinian families were exterminated by the occupation, leaving only one person alive, and the number of members of these families exceeded 9,000 martyrs. (Ministry of Health).
◻️ (57,136) martyrs and missing persons.
◻️ (11,200) missing persons who did not reach hospitals.
◻️ (45,936) martyrs who reached hospitals (Ministry of Health).
◻️ (17,841) child martyrs.
◻️ (240) infants were born and martyred in the genocide war.
◻️ (858) children were martyred during the war and were less than a year old.
◻️ (44) were martyred as a result of malnutrition, food shortages and famine.
◻️ (8) were martyred as a result of the severe cold in the tents of the displaced, including 7 children.
◻️ (12,298) female martyrs killed by the "Israeli" occupation.
◻️ (1068) martyrs from medical staff (Ministry of Health).
◻️ (94) martyrs from civil defense killed by the "Israeli" occupation.
◻️ (202) martyrs from journalists killed by the "Israeli" occupation.
◻️ (736) elements and police of providing assistance killed by the "Israeli" occupation.
◻️ (149) Crimes of the occupation targeting elements, police and providing assistance.
◻️ (7) Mass graves established by the occupation inside hospitals.
◻️ (520) martyrs were recovered from 7 mass graves inside hospitals.
◻️ (109,274) wounded and injured arrived at hospitals. (Ministry of Health).
◻️ (399) journalists and media professionals injured and wounded.
◻️ (70%) of the victims are children and women.
◻️ (218) shelters and displacement centers targeted by the "Israeli" occupation.
◻️ Only (10%) of the area of ​​the Gaza Strip is claimed by the Israeli occupation to be "humanitarian areas".
◻️ (35,074) children living without their parents or without one of them.
◻️ (12,132) women lost their husbands during the genocide war.
◻️ (3,500) children are at risk of death due to malnutrition and food shortages.
◻️ (246) days after the "Israeli" occupation closed the last crossing in the Gaza Strip.
◻️ (12,660) wounded need to travel abroad for treatment.
◻️ (12,500) cancer patients face death and need treatment.
◻️ (3,000) patients with various diseases need treatment abroad.
◻️ (2,136,026) cases of infectious diseases due to displacement. (Ministry of Health)
◻️ (71,338) cases of viral hepatitis infection due to displacement.
◻️ (60,000) pregnant women are approximately at risk due to the lack of health care.
◻️ (350,000) chronic patients are at risk due to the occupation's prevention of the entry of medicines.
◻️ (6,600) detainees arrested by the occupation from the Gaza Strip during the crime of genocide.
◻️ (331) cases of arrest of health personnel (the occupation executed 3 of them inside prisons).
◻️ (43) cases of arrest of journalists whose names were known.
◻️ (26) cases of arrest of civil defense personnel.
◻️ (2) Million displaced people in the Gaza Strip.
◻️ (110,000) tents were worn out and became unfit for the displaced.
◻️ (214) government headquarters were destroyed by the "Israeli" occupation.
◻️ (136) schools and universities were completely destroyed by the occupation.
◻️ (355) schools and universities were partially destroyed by the occupation.
